# Pineland Milkweed (Asclepias obovata)

> A modest greenish-yellow-flowered milkweed of dry southeastern pinelands and sandy roadsides, with softly hairy paddle-shaped leaves.

## Key facts

| Field | Value |
| --- | --- |
| Scientific name | Asclepias obovata Elliott |
| Genus | Asclepias |
| Family | Apocynaceae |
| Common names | Pineland Milkweed, Obovate Milkweed |
| Status | Native |
| Height | 1 ft–2.5 ft |
| Spread | 1 ft–2 ft |
| Flower color | green, yellow |
| Bloom period | June to August |
| Light | Full sun |
| Soil moisture | Dry |
| USDA zones | 7-9 |
| Leaf arrangement | opposite |
| Leaf shape | oblong |
| Sap | Milky latex |
| Root system | Deep taproot, resents transplanting |
| Seed stratification | 30 days cold-moist |
| Monarch value (0-5) | 3 |
| Garden value (0-5) | 2 |
| Nectar value (0-5) | 2 |
| US states recorded | Alabama, Florida, Georgia,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as |

## Identification

- Leaves broadest above the middle, blunt-tipped and downy.
- Greenish-yellow flowers in small axillary clusters.
- Dry sandy pine woods and their margins.

## Ecology

A summer-blooming host in southern pine country, used by monarchs and queens.
